Pine Hills Neighborhood Overview
Neighborhood Overview
Nestled on the southeastern edge of Sargent, Georgia, Pine Hills is a well-established, residential neighborhood prized for its mature landscape, quiet streets, and strong sense of community. Developed primarily in the 1960s and 1970s, the area was one of Sargent's first major suburban expansions, attracting families seeking spacious lots and a tranquil environment just minutes from the city's commercial core. The neighborhood's namesake pine trees line the gently curving streets, providing ample shade and a consistent, verdant character that has been meticulously maintained over the decades.
Pine Hills is defined by its convenient yet secluded location. It is bordered by the reputable Sargent Park to the north, offers quick access to State Route 42 for regional commuting, and lies within a 10-minute drive of downtown Sargent's revitalized main street. This positioning offers residents the best of both worlds: a retreat-like atmosphere with city amenities close at hand. The neighborhood is not a through-way for traffic, which reinforces its peaceful, family-oriented ambiance and makes it a hidden gem within the broader Sargent market.
Housing & Real Estate
The housing stock in Pine Hills is predominantly comprised of classic, single-family ranch-style homes and split-levels, reflecting its mid-century origins. Homes typically sit on generous, wooded lots averaging 0.3 to 0.5 acres, offering privacy and room for outdoor living. Architecturally, the neighborhood features brick and siding exteriors, carports or attached garages, and practical, modifiable floor plans that often range from 1,800 to 2,800 square feet. A limited number of larger, custom-built homes from later infill development can be found on the neighborhood's perimeter.
Pine Hills is overwhelmingly an owner-occupied community, with an estimated 85% homeownership rate. The rental market is minimal, consisting mainly of a few long-term tenants in privately owned properties. As of recent market analysis, the price range for homes in Pine Hills typically falls between $325,000 and $475,000, with the variance largely dependent on square footage, lot size, and modernization level. Recent trends show a strong demand for move-in ready properties that have been updated with modern kitchens and bathrooms, while well-preserved original homes attract buyers looking for a value-add opportunity.
Lifestyle & Amenities
Life in Pine Hills centers around quiet suburban living with convenient access to daily necessities and recreation. The neighborhood itself is low on commercial activity, preserving its residential feel, but a five-minute drive leads to the Sargent Plaza shopping center, featuring a grocery anchor, pharmacy, several casual dining restaurants, and essential services. For more diverse dining and boutique shopping, residents head to downtown Sargent, known for its farm-to-table eateries and local shops. Walkability within Pine Hills is moderate; sidewalks are present on most streets, making for pleasant evening strolls and neighborly interaction, but a car is necessary for most errands.
The crown jewel of the area's amenities is the adjacent 50-acre Sargent Park, accessible via a dedicated pedestrian pathway from the neighborhood's north end. The park offers extensive walking trails, sports fields, a community pool, and picnic pavilions, serving as a de facto backyard for Pine Hills families. Public transit is limited to a county bus line that runs along the neighborhood's eastern edge, connecting to downtown and a regional transfer hub. For entertainment, residents often partake in community-organized events like the annual Pine Hills Fall Festival and block parties, reinforcing the tight-knit social fabric.
Schools & Education
Pine Hills is served by the highly regarded Sargent City School District, a key driver of its enduring appeal to families. Students are zoned for Pine Hills Elementary School (located within the neighborhood boundaries), Sargent Middle School, and Sargent High School. Pine Hills Elementary, in particular, benefits from immense community support and consistently earns state ratings above average, with strong parent-teacher association involvement. The schools are known for their robust academic programs, manageable class sizes, and a wide array of extracurricular activities.
For private education options, several well-established institutions are within a reasonable commute, including St. Mary's Catholic School (K-8) and the non-denominational Sargent Christian Academy. Higher education opportunities are provided by Sargent Technical College, a two-year institution specializing in allied health and skilled trades, located approximately 15 miles away. The neighborhood's proximity to quality public schools is a cornerstone of its real estate value proposition and a primary consideration for the demographic it attracts.
Community & Demographics
Pine Hills is characterized by a stable, predominantly middle-to-upper-middle-class demographic. The population is largely composed of established families, empty-nesters who originally moved to the area decades ago, and a growing number of young professionals starting families. The age distribution is bimodal, with significant clusters in the 35-55 age range (families with school-aged children) and the 65+ range (long-term residents). This mix creates a dynamic community where tradition and newer energy coexist.
The community character is actively engaged and neighborly. A voluntary neighborhood association organizes social events, maintains a community watch program, and advocates for residents' interests with the city council. Demographically, the neighborhood is less diverse than the Sargent average, with a majority White population, though recent turnover has begun to introduce more diversity. The overall atmosphere is one of pride of ownership, mutual respect among neighbors, and a collective investment in maintaining the quality and safety of the environment.
Real Estate Market Insights
For real estate professionals, Pine Hills represents a stable and appreciating market segment with predictable buyer demand. Its investment potential lies in its enduring appeal to a family-centric demographic, driven by solid schools and lot size—a commodity becoming rarer in newer developments. The neighborhood is in a mature phase of its lifecycle, meaning major value gains come from strategic renovations and updates to the original housing stock. Investors and flippers have identified certain pockets where bringing a property to modern standards yields strong returns, given the premium placed on move-in ready homes.
Current market dynamics favor sellers, with low inventory and days-on-market metrics consistently below the Sargent average. However, the market is not overheated; appreciation is steady and sustainable. Buyer competition is most fierce for homes that have been updated, while original-condition homes present opportunities for buyers seeking equity growth through sweat equity. For agents, understanding the nuanced value drivers—such as proximity to the park, lot topography, and the quality of updates—is key to accurate pricing and successful marketing.
